ESPE Clinical Fellowship – European Society for Paediatric Endocrinology

 

About

The Clinical Fellowship aims to promote the development of patient care, clinical management and clinical research in paediatric endocrinology through a training programme in a European Clinical centre.

Eligibility

Fellow

  • Applicants for the Fellowship should be fully trained in Paediatrics and/or have started training in Paediatric Endocrinology.
  • All applicants should have the intention to pursue a career in Paediatric Endocrinology.
  • Applicants should be supported by a Promoter coming from their current Department (Home Centre) and from the Head of the Department.

Home Centre

Commitment for a position in Paediatric Endocrinology following the completion of the Fellowship with, at least, preservation of the Candidate’s working post/position and, preferably, support for the possibility of promotion subsequently locally or in another national centre on successful completion of the Fellowship.

Host Centre

If an applicant has a specific host centre request, then a support letter or email from the host centre could be attached (optional).

30 September Application Deadline

Notification of acceptance/refusal: 31 December
If successful, the applicant should confirm acceptance within 2 weeks of notification.
Once the fellowship is accepted, the fellow should confirm the date of commencement of fellowship to the committee by: 15 February .
The fellowship should be commenced latest by: 30 June (of the following year).
